Everton goalkeeper Tim Howard admits he may find it very difficult to continue playing later on in his career.
The 33-year old USA international this week signed a new contract with the Toffees to keep him at Goodison Park until 2016 and he suggests it may be his last deal as he will be 37 when it concludes.
"At 33 I find it difficult to figure out how the 40-year-old goalkeepers get out of bed in the morning.
"As long as I am healthy and still have the desire to compete I have to consider continuing to play, but as you get to 38, 39, 40 those things start to diminish, especially physically.""Having done this contract it was a real marker for me. When it is finished I will take stock and figure out what I want to do," Howard said.
